Dr Michael Richard Lynch OBE FREng is Chief Executive of Autonomy Corporation. Described by the Financial Times as "the doyen of European software" and generally considered one of Britain's most successful technology entrepreneurs, Lynch has been called by the Sunday Times the nearest thing Britain has to Bill Gates.

He is perhaps best known as the co-founder and CEO of Autonomy Corporation, a company he grew from a start up to be the UK's largest software company with a market capitalisation of over $5.5Bn. His entrepreneurship is associated with Silicon Fen. He is a leader in the area of computer understanding of unstructured information, an area which is becoming known as meaning-based computing. He is considered a rare example of a European academic turned technology entrepreneur who has taken a start up through to being a global leader. Lynch is paid an annual base salary of £250,000 for his role at Autonomy Corporation.
